Contrail Releases the FA50 for Microsoft Flight Simulator 2020 and 2024


Business aviation has gained a new three-engine thoroughbred as Contrail officially releases its highly anticipated FA50 for Microsoft Flight Simulator 2020 and Microsoft Flight Simulator 2024.




Developed over approximately two and a half years, the FA50 is Contrail's first complete aircraft produced under its own development brand. The classic business jet combines old-school cockpit character with a carefully selected collection of digital avionics, creating a flight deck that sits comfortably between the analog and glass-cockpit eras.




Classic Trijet Performance



Based on the Dassault Falcon 50, the aircraft is powered by three engines and is designed for long-range corporate operations. The real-world Falcon 50 is certified to operate as high as 49,000 feet and is capable of transcontinental and, under favorable conditions, transatlantic flights.




That gives virtual pilots plenty of possibilities, from short executive hops between regional airports to longer missions connecting major international business centers.




A Blend of Analog and Digital Avionics



The Contrail FA50 features a digital Collins 85C EFIS installation alongside a Garmin MX20 multifunction display and a GNS-XLS flight-management system. A custom autopilot has also been developed for the aircraft rather than relying entirely on default simulator systems.




Additional features highlighted during development include:





  • Functional weather radar with tilt support




  • Datalink weather displayed through the avionics




  • Detailed passenger cabin and galley




  • Animated passengers




  • Native GSX compatibility




  • Ground and ramp equipment




  • Exterior logo lighting




  • Detailed aircraft animations





Contrail has also worked to reproduce the Falcon's distinctive cockpit materials, sound environment and business-jet atmosphere.




Available for Both Generations of Microsoft Flight Simulator



The FA50 is available for the PC versions of both Microsoft Flight Simulator 2020 and Microsoft Flight Simulator 2024, including native support for the newer simulator.




The initial release is available through the Contrail store. Marketplace and Xbox versions are expected later, although those releases will depend on the usual Marketplace submission and approval process.
